Re: [RFC] powerpc: restore TOC when static longjmp to shared object
On 16/05/2018 16:36, Rogerio Alves wrote:
> Attached to this email I am sending the first version of the patch but I have a problem with this patch. I can't make the test work. By some reason it can't find the .so needed by the test:
>
> FAIL:
> ./setjmp-bug21895.so: c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ory
>
> Notice that if I manually execute the command on make check stdout inside the folder it works fine. I'd appreciate any help on that.
>
> Regards
>
> Em 15-05-2018 17:48, Tulio Magno Quites Machado Filho escreveu:
>> Florian Weimer <fw@deneb.enyo.de> writes:
>>
>>> * Rogerio Alves:
>>>
>>>> One simple solution would be always restore the TOC pointer by uncomment
>>>> the line bellow:
>>>>
>>>> /* std r2,FRAME_TOC_SAVE(r1) Restore the TOC save area. */
>>>>
>>>> Or maybe we can check if we have a valid TOC pointer before restore it,
>>>> instead #if defined SHARED.
>>>
>>> Is the register reserved for the TOC pointer in static builds, too?
>>> Then I suggest to unconditionally save nad restore it; not doing so
>>> looks like a pointless micro-optimization.
>>>
>>> Another problem with sharing jump buffers across static dlopen is that
>>> you might not have identical pointer guard values.
>>>
>>>> I would like to request for comments on this matter: Should we fix/work
>>>> this? Is feasible to change longjmp to always restore TOC pointer?
>>>
>>> Does setjmp already save it unonditionally?
>>>
>>> Removal of static dlopen is still some time away; it's likely not
>>> going to happen in this cycle, and the fix looks simple enough.
>>
>> If static dlopen is still going to be supported for some cycles, I also agree
>> it should be saved and restored unconditionally.

> From eb9895f1548c8f6e1826095aee3221eaf9ce84c9 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
> From: Rogerio Alves <rcardoso@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
> Date: Wed, 16 May 2018 14:20:53 -0500
> Subject: [PATCH] [PATCH v1] powerpc: Always restore TOC on longjmp.
>
> This patch change longjmp to always restore the TOC pointer (r2 register)
> to the caller frame on powerpc. This is related to bug 21895[1] that reports
> a situation where you have a static longjmp to a shared object file.
>
> [1] https://sourceware.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=21895
